What if a tiny AI model could run complex tasks on everyday devices? Meet Needle2, the future of smart device intelligence. This language model packs powerful capabilities into an astonishingly small package, making it a standout for consumer electronics.
Needle2 is a lightweight, agentic language model designed to enhance the functionality of devices like smartphones, wearables, and IoT gadgets. Its compact size—just a single 14MB binary—means it can run efficiently even on budget hardware.

What Makes Needle2 Stand Out?
Needle2 stands out with its size-to-performance ratio. With only 45 million parameters, it's much smaller than traditional models like FunctionGemma or LFM2.5 but competes at similar accuracy levels Cactus. It's built using a novel compression technique called CQ2-bit by Cactus Quants, allowing it to fit into just 28MB of RAM during full sessions.
